Actual Weight vs. Volumetric Weight: A Logistics Breakdown

Shipping a rotomolded cooler requires a precise understanding of physical dimensions versus displacement. The YETI Tundra 35 is a dense, high-performance item that necessitates a thorough shipping analysis to avoid unexpected costs. You should consult the shipping calculator to compare priority vs. economy rates before finalizing your purchase.

Metric Estimate
Box Weight Approx. 20 lbs (9.1 kg)
Box Dimensions 21.3" x 16.1" x 15.5" (Medium-Bulky)
Battery Check No Lithium Batteries (Non-Electronic)

Volumetric Warning

While the actual weight is approximately 20 lbs, the external dimensions of the Tundra 35 mean that carriers will likely apply volumetric weight charges. In the world of logistics, the space an item occupies vs. its literal mass determines the freight class. Because the cooler is a hollow, rigid structure, it cannot be compressed. We recommend consolidating this shipment with smaller, soft-good items like apparel or towels to maximize the internal space of the shipping container.

Restricted Goods vs. Approved Outdoor Equipment

Before initiating any shipment to India, it is professional protocol to verify the contents against current customs regulations. While the Tundra 35 is a passive cooling system and generally safe for transit, you must ensure no pressurized containers or dry ice are included in the package. Check the latest list of prohibited items to ensure your shipment complies with international aviation and Indian import laws.
